Creature-of-No-Words lives a happy life on his own, but one day he gets a feeling like "the chill touch of ice," and nothing can lift his sadness. Just then Creature-of-Words arrives and senses his despair. How can she help him communicate and be happy once more? This is a powerful picture book about communication and friendship, from an award-winning duo.
